Syrian forces killed several men from an "armed terrorist group" trying to cross from the Turkish border into Syria.
Syria's northern border with Turkey has been a regular crossing point for army defectors supporting the nine-month revolt against President Bashar al-Assad.
"Special forces were able to kill and wound several gunmen and seized some weapons, ammunitions, army uniforms, communication tools and fake identity cards," Reuters said quoting SANA, without giving a specific casualty count.
